But gravel doesn’t improve drainage in any meaningful way, and you’re p...A U.S. quart is equal to 32 U.S. fluid ounces, 1/4 th of a gallon, or 2 pints. It should not be confused with the Imperial quart, which is about 20% larger. WENZHOU 5540 Garden Magic Top Soil ...How many quarts in a cubic foot? 1 Cubic foot (cu ft) is equal to 29.9220779 quarts (qt). To convert cubic feet to quarts, multiply the cubic foot value by 29.9220779. For example, to convert 2 cubic feet to quarts, multiply 29.9220779 by 2, that makes 59.84 quarts equal to 2 cubic feet. cubic feet to quarts conversion formula:Potting soil is usually sold in bags by the cubic feet (cu. ft.).
